aboutsummaryrefslogtreecommitdiff
path: root/hw/s390x/s390-pci-inst.c
AgeCommit message (Expand)AuthorFilesLines
2023-01-09Merge tag 'pull-request-2023-01-09' of https://gitlab.com/thuth/qemu into sta...Peter Maydell1-1/+1
2023-01-09exec/memory: Expose memory_region_access_valid()Philippe Mathieu-Daudé1-1/+1
2023-01-08include/hw/pci: Split pci_device.h off pci.hMarkus Armbruster1-0/+1
2022-12-16hw/s390x/s390-pci-inst.c: Use device_cold_reset() to reset PCI devicesPeter Maydell1-1/+1
2022-12-15s390x/pci: coalesce unmap operationsMatthew Rosato1-0/+51
2022-11-06s390x/pci: RPCIT second pass when mappings exhaustedMatthew Rosato1-7/+22
2022-09-26s390x/pci: enable adapter event notification for interpreted devicesMatthew Rosato1-2/+38
2022-09-26s390x/pci: enable for load/store interpretationMatthew Rosato1-0/+16
2021-12-17s390x/pci: add supported DT information to clp responseMatthew Rosato1-0/+1
2021-12-17s390x/pci: use the passthrough measurement update intervalMatthew Rosato1-2/+3
2021-12-17s390x/pci: don't use hard-coded dma range in reg_ioatMatthew Rosato1-4/+5
2021-09-06s390x: Replace PAGE_SIZE, PAGE_SHIFT and PAGE_MASKThomas Huth1-4/+4
2021-05-02Do not include cpu.h if it's not really necessaryThomas Huth1-1/+0
2021-03-04s390x/pci: restore missing Query PCI Function CLP dataMatthew Rosato1-0/+5
2021-01-08Remove superfluous timer_del() callsPeter Maydell1-1/+0
2020-12-21s390x/pci: Fix memory_region_access_valid callMatthew Rosato1-4/+6
2020-12-21s390x/pci: fix pcistb lengthMatthew Rosato1-2/+2
2020-12-08memory: Add IOMMUTLBEventEugenio Pérez1-11/+16
2020-11-18s390x/pci: fix endianness issuesCornelia Huck1-2/+14
2020-11-01s390x/pci: use a PCI Function structurePierre Morel1-6/+2
2020-11-01s390x/pci: use a PCI Group structurePierre Morel1-9/+14
2020-11-01s390x/pci: Honor DMA limits set by vfioMatthew Rosato1-6/+39
2020-11-01s390x/pci: Move header files to include/hw/s390xMatthew Rosato1-2/+2
2020-01-30add device_legacy_reset function to prepare for reset api changeDamien Hedde1-1/+1
2019-10-09target/s390x: Remove ilen parameter from s390_program_interruptRichard Henderson1-29/+29
2019-09-03memory: Access MemoryRegion with endiannessTony Nguyen1-2/+4
2019-09-03hw/s390x: Hard code size with MO_{8|16|32|64}Tony Nguyen1-2/+1
2019-09-03hw/s390x: Access MemoryRegion with MemOpTony Nguyen1-3/+5
2019-07-18s390x/pci: add some fallthrough annotationsCornelia Huck1-0/+2
2019-06-12Include qemu-common.h exactly where neededMarkus Armbruster1-1/+0
2019-01-18s390x/pci: add common function measurement blockYi Min Zhao1-3/+130
2018-06-15iommu: Add IOMMU index argument to notifier APIsPeter Maydell1-2/+2
2018-05-31Make memory_region_access_valid() take a MemTxAttrs argumentPeter Maydell1-1/+2
2018-04-30s390x/kvm: cleanup calls to cpu_synchronize_state()David Hildenbrand1-8/+0
2018-02-09s390x/pci: use the right pal and pba in reg_ioat()Yi Min Zhao1-0/+2
2018-02-09s390x/pci: fixup global refreshYi Min Zhao1-8/+45
2018-02-09s390x/pci: fixup the code walking IOMMU tablesYi Min Zhao1-35/+29
2017-12-14s390x/pci: search for subregion inside the BARsPierre Morel1-19/+25
2017-12-14s390x/pci: move the memory region write from pcistgPierre Morel1-10/+17
2017-12-14s390x/pci: move the memory region read from pcilgPierre Morel1-4/+11
2017-12-14s390x/pci: rework PCI STORE BLOCKPierre Morel1-24/+39
2017-12-14s390x/pci: rework PCI LOADPierre Morel1-11/+14
2017-12-14s390x/pci: rework PCI STOREPierre Morel1-16/+25
2017-12-14s390x/pci: factor out endianess conversionPierre Morel1-26/+32
2017-12-14s390x: handle exceptions during s390_cpu_virt_mem_rw() correctly (TCG)David Hildenbrand1-0/+7
2017-12-14s390x/pci: pass the retaddr to all PCI instructionsDavid Hildenbrand1-40/+43
2017-09-19s390x/pci: remove idx from msix msg dataYi Min Zhao1-24/+0
2017-08-30s390x/pci: fixup trap_msix()Yi Min Zhao1-2/+2
2017-07-14memory/iommu: introduce IOMMUMemoryRegionClassAlexey Kardashevskiy1-1/+4
2017-07-14memory/iommu: QOM'fy IOMMU MemoryRegionAlexey Kardashevskiy1-4/+4